MARVELOUS MALFATTI 
1 c. cooked, drained, chopped spinach (or 10 oz. frozen, cooked, drained and chopped)
1 1/2 c. Ricotta cheese
1 c. Italian-seasoned bread crumbs
2 eggs, beaten
1/4 c. Parmesan cheese
1/4 c. minced scallions
1 tbsp. basil
1/4 tsp. nutmeg
1 clove garlic, minced or pressed
1/2 tsp. salt
Flour

Drain cooked spinach very dry. Combine with all ingredients, except flour. Refrigerate 1 hour. Bring saucepot half full of salted water to a simmer. Drop spinach cheese mixture by tablespoons into flour and roll each lightly into 3 inch long fingers. Drop these "fingers" into the barely simmering water. When they rise to the top, remove with a slotted spoon (approximately 3 to 5 minutes). Transfer to a warm square dish. Cover with your favorite tomato sauce. Bake in a 350 degree oven for 20 minutes. Makes 12 to 14 "fingers". Serves 4 to 6.
